Thinking about moving to Tennessee but can’t decide between Chattanooga and Nashville? In this in-depth comparison we break down cost of living, median home prices, rent, salaries, taxes, job growth, traffic, outdoor recreation, culture, schools, and airports to help you choose the city that fits your lifestyle and budget.
▶ Chattanooga offers cheaper housing, lightning-fast EPB Gig City internet, and immediate access to hiking, climbing, and the Tennessee Riverwalk.
▶ Nashville delivers big-city energy, higher salaries, a world-class music scene, and an international airport—at a higher price tag.
